为负载和 Web 性能测试创建和使用自定义插件

自定义插件使用您编写的并附加到负载测试或 Web 性能测试的代码。 可使用负载测试 API 和 Web 性能测试 API 为测试创建自定义插件以扩展内置功能。

提示

利用 Visual Studio 2010 旗舰版,可以向负载测试添加多个插件。 在 Visual Studio 2010 旗舰版之前,您只能对每个负载测试使用一个插件。 您不必再将所有外接程序代码放入同一插件中。

任务

任务

关联主题

为负载测试创建自定义插件:可使用负载测试 API 创建自定义插件以向负载测试添加更多的测试功能。

为 Web 性能测试创建自定义插件:可使用 Web 性能测试 API 创建自定义插件以向 Web 性能测试添加更多的测试功能,包括在请求级别上。 还可以创建 Web 服务测试。

此外,可以创建一个 Web 记录器插件,该插件可在记录 Web 性能测试后并在该测试显示在 Web 性能测试结果查看器中之前修改该测试。

向 Web 性能测试结果查看器添加 UI 功能:可以使用 Visual Studio 外接程序向 Web 性能测试结果查看器添加多个 UI 功能。

创建自定义 HTTP 正文编辑器:可以创建自定义编辑器来编辑来自 Web 服务的二进制或字符串 http XML 响应。

参考

WebTestPlugin

WebTestRequestPlugin

ILoadTestPlugin

WebTestRecorderPlugin

Microsoft.VisualStudio.TestTools.LoadTesting

请参见

任务

演练:创建编码的 Web 性能测试

如何:创建编码的 Web 性能测试

概念

测试应用程序性能和压力

其他资源

使用负载测试分析器分析负载测试结果

有关 Visual Studio ALM 测试工具的 API 参考